The Canadian Air Transport Security Authority (CATSA) has 1 (one) exciting indeterminate opportunity within the Operations branch at the CATSA HQ.

Summary of responsibilities:

The Senior Analyst, Advanced Analytics is responsible for developing and implementing quantitative models and tools, including artificial intelligence models, to support decision-making and operational planning. The incumbent is also responsible for conducting advanced data analysis. What you need to succeed
To qualify for the position, you must have:
  • Graduation from a recognized university with a specialization in operations research, mathematics, statistics, computer science, engineering, physics, or another speciality relevant to the duties of the position.
  • A minimum of four years of experience in data mining, data analysis and synthesis.
  • Knowledge and experience developing artificial intelligence and machine learning models.
  • Previous experience in programming and developing mathematical models using software such as SAS, R, SPSS, MATLAB, Python.
  • Advanced knowledge of mathematical and statistical concepts and application.
  • Experience working with large datasets.
  • Experience in the development of mathematical models to support business needs.
  • Experience drafting clear and concise reports and presentations with a strong attention to detail.
  • Demonstrated ability to develop and deliver presentations that synthesize findings in a business context.


This position is best suited to individuals with the following skills and abilities:
  • Strong technical and programming skills with an emphasis on analytical software.
  • Strong mathematical skills with the ability to understand and apply concepts.
  • Strong analytical skills and experience with some of the following analytical methodologies: statistical analysis, machine learning, forecasting, discrete event simulation, mathematical programming, stochastic modeling, visual analytics, etc.
  • Knowledge and experience with computer vision models.
  • Strong skills in research, analysis and problem-solving accompanied by an ability to synthesize and interpret complex information and situations.
  • Ability to understand client's needs and translate business requirements into technical directions.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ills with ability to clearly communicate ideas and results to non-technical and business audience.
  • Meticulous, rigorous, and thorough.
